When I need to be anchored in Scripture

In a world of shifting loyalties, devious cons, and ever-evolving ideas, we need to know where to anchor our souls. Only God can point us in the right direction. We need to be anchored in revelation. How do we do that?

A daily time in God’s Word is a good first step. It works truth into our minds on a regular basis. But is that really enough to protect us against error?

Here’s a good pattern to follow: First, ask God every day to convince your heart of His truth and to give you discernment. Second, find at least one verse a week to memorize. Chew on it, let it sink in, look at it from every angle, and come up with specific ways to apply it. Third, don’t just study God’s Word. Fall in love with it. God has a way of working into our hearts the things that we love. According to Colossians 3:16, we are to let the Word of Christ richly dwell within us. Let it richly dwell in you this week.

Every word of God proves true. He is a shield to all who come to him for protection.

Proverbs 30:5
